DESCRIPTION:Staff – It’s an ART!Attracting, Retaining and Training staff in Agribusinesses.\nAre you a Farm Business, Contractor, Rural Merchant or local Ag Business working on attracting, retaining and training staff in your business?\nHolbrook Landcare Networking is bringing guest speaker Neville Brady from Browsup Consulting to Holbrook for a great workshop on how you can identify and tackle the low hanging fruit in your agribusiness to improve your capacity to attract, retain and training staff.\nNeville brings to us 25-years of experience working with businesses to identify gaps, opportunities and practical, implementable solutions to increase workplace and team efficiencies and productivity in agricultural businesses. Neville’s approach is a straight-forward working with producers to develop the right documents to sell their workplaces and honing in on some of the communication, leadership, and employee-employer fault that might be capping your business’ capacity to attract and retain staff.\nThis workshop is an outcome of our ‘Supporting On-Farm Labour During the Dry Times Project’ a Project which was designed to identify the barriers local farm businesses experience when looking to attract, retain and train on-farm labour.
